June 14 …Protection from Deception1 John 2:24-29

ICEBREAKER: What is a “promise” that you have heard a manufacturer make about their product?

 

                People are deceived all the time, but spiritual deception is the most destructive of all because it has eternal consequences.  As John warns about deception he points to our protection.

There are various levels of maturity and the fact that no matter how mature or immature, each believer needs to be concerned about their spiritual life. This passage speaks of victory in a love for the word and the Father that confirms our spiritual destiny giving us a realistic eternal outlook.

 

 

 

V24 – What does Colossians 3:16 say about abiding in God? (Our response to God, to each other, our outlook)

 

V27 – How can we identify the Spirit teaching, helping us as we testify regarding Christ? (See John 14:26, 15:26, 16:12-15) Consider who is actually speaking, and the source. Consider the reliability of the subject, the promise from God and our recollection.

 

V28 - What effect does the hope of Christ’s return produce in a believer? (Regarding the future, God’s promise in His Word, our standing and this present world) Read 2 Peter 3:4-11 Together. Any further thoughts?

 

V29 – The word ‘know’ implies experimental knowledge. What experimental knowledge do you have in your standing in Christ? (Think about your old life, answered prayer, Lessons learned through difficulty that brought you closer to God,  God’s Word, worship, and Relationships.)
